Ornate sunbird (Cinnyris ornatus)
The ornate sunbird (Cinnyris ornatus) is a species of bird in the sunbird family Nectariniidae that is endemic to Mainland Southeast Asia, Sumatra, Java, Borneo and the Lesser Sunda Islands.
The ornate sunbird is resident in Myanmar, southern China, Thailand, Cambodia, Vietnam, Malaysia and Indonesia.
The name Cinnyris is from the Ancient Greek kinnyris, an unknown small bird mentioned by Hesychius of Alexandria.
The specific epithet is Latin meaning "ornate" or "adorned".
